Abstract:
The present invention relates to cellular system and especially to handover between cells on different frequency carriers in an OFDM system or between cells in 2 systems adopting different radio access technologies (RAT), at least one of them being OFDM technology. A problem is the intra-cell interference impact on the quality a connected mode terminal measures in the own cell and in neighbor cells. This is a problem for cells based on OFDM technology, because intra-cell interference has no impact as compared to the inter-cell interference on the quality provided by the cell to a connected mode terminal, whereas in UTRA the intra-cell and inter-cell interference have the same impact on the quality provided. The solution to the problem is based on the insight that for cells that are located on the same site, the eNode B possess information on the power transmitted on the respective frequency carrier, and can adjust the quality as reported from the terminal on co-located OFDM cells. The adjusted quality measure enables an improved evaluation of the quality of co-located cells, for a potential handover. The invention also relates to embodiments on a 2-step handover, wherein handover to inter-frequency, or inter-RAT cell on another site is made as a handover to co-located inter-frequency/inter-RAT cell and a handover to an intra-frequency cell located at the other site.
